• Graduate of Bachelor of Fine Arts, major in Advertising at the University of Sto. Tomas, Manila
  • Started his business 1981 and one of the pioneering members of the Fashion Designers Association of the Philippines (FDAP).
  • Elected as president of the FDAP for 3 terms (1998-1999, 1999-2000 and 2005-2006)
  • Won the “Piña Award”, for his outstanding Haute Couture designs in the Manila Fashion Designers Awards in 1999.
  • Won the grand prize for best costume in the “Carnival in Rio in Manila” and a trip to Rio de Janeiro, Brazil in 2000.
  • Won in the Annual Flores de Mayo, organized by the Congregasion de Santisimo Niño de Jesus in 1993, 2001 and 2006.
  • In Manila, he mounted solo fashion shows namely : Viva San Diego (1999) and Disenyo at Musika with the UP Concert Chorus (2003).
  • In Honolulu, U.S.A he was invited to showcase his 2001 collection for the Filipino Business Woman’s Association.
  • In Jakarta, Indonesia he was invited to show his collections by the Filipino Community in Indonesia (FILCOMIN) in 2001 and 2003.
  • In Singapore, he represented our country at the Asean Fashion Connections in 1989.
  • Annually, he participates in the “Estilo Filipino, U.S. Fashion Group Tour” that showcases their Filipiñana and contemporary collections for the Filipino communities in New York, Los Angeles, Florida, Chicago, New Jersey, Missouri among others.
  • In London, together with selected FDAP Designers they were invited by the Overseas Woman’s Club to showcase their 2001 and 2002 collections.
  • In the local theater scene, he did costumes for “The Lion, the Witch and the Wardrobe “, “The Wizard of OZ” , “Alladin”, “Rent”, “ The Sound of Music”, “Man of La Mancha”, “M. Butterfly”, “Little Mermaid” among others.
  • And movie costumes for ‘Sarah ang Munting Princesa” and “Cedie”
  • In his 2006 term as FDAP President, he led the group to publish the coffeetable book ‘Sagala, the Queen of Philippine Festivals, which they launch at the Century Park Hotel in Manila, The Philippine Consulate in Manhattan, New York and at the Pasadena Hilton Hotel in California, Eleven (11) of the FDAP members also mounted fashion shows, exhibits and participated in the Annual Philippine Independence Day Parade, along Madison Ave., in New York, U.S.A.
  • He is a regular participant of the annual Philippine Fashion Week.
